Quote:
Originally Posted by weaponrcamry View Post
Very nice pictures... I like your yaris a lot. What are the wheels and size???
Drag DR-4 Gloss Black alloy wheels with Nitto NeoGen ZR high performance all-season tires. The wheels are 17"x7" with a 40+mm offset and a four bolt pattern, 4x(100/114.3). The wheels are 10 spoke and weigh about 16.5 lbs. The Nitto tires are 215/40 ZR17 NeoGen ZR M+S all season performance tires.

Quote:
Originally Posted by RogueYaris View Post
I wish we could've joined you. We opted for a day at the lake instead. Even in a good MPG car, gas prices suck.
I hear ya on sucky gas prices. I filled up before the trip, and when I got to the meeting point at castle rock. Going over a mountain pass fully loaded, it took me about 6 gallons. It was 52 miles from the meeting point to the Johnson ridge observatory with a 6% grade going up. Up and down I only dropped 1 bar. Some of the Scion owners were almost empty when they got to castle rock, I could have made it there, up to the top, and almost back home on a tank. All in all I think I spent about $45 or so for gas on the entire trip.
